Citizens’ convention endorses legalization of euthanasia and assisted suicide in France Catholic News Agency 27 Feb, 2023 • 3 Min Read
Study: Nations with euthanasia, assisted suicide have higher suicide rates Simon Caldwell10 Nov, 2022 3 Min Read